What is Omada Health Receivables Turnover?

Omada Health OMDA -1.13% 12 Receivables Turnover is 5.75 as of Mar. 2026. GuruFocus rates OMDA with a GF Score™ of 12/100. The stock has 1 warning sign investors should review. Among 657 Healthcare Providers & Services companies, Omada Health ranks better than 84.17% on this metric.

The Receivables Turnover ratio measures the number of times a company collects its average accounts receivable balance. It is calculated as Revenue divided by average Accounts Receivable. An efficient company has a higher accounts receivable turnover ratio while an inefficient company has a lower ratio. Omada Health's Revenue for the three months ended in Mar. 2026 was $78.0 Mil. Omada Health's average Accounts Receivable for the three months ended in Mar. 2026 was $13.6 Mil. Hence, Omada Health's Receivables Turnover for the three months ended in Mar. 2026 was 5.75.

Omada Health Receivables Turnover Calculation

Receivables Turnover measures the number of times a company collects its average accounts receivable balance.

Omada Health's Receivables Turnover for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Receivables Turnover (A: Dec. 2025 )
=Revenue / Average Accounts Receivable
=Revenue (A: Dec. 2025 ) / ((Accounts Receivable (A: Dec. 2024 ) + Accounts Receivable (A: Dec. 2025 )) / count )
=260.21 / ((9.483 + 13.563) / 2 )
=260.21 / 11.523
=22.58

Omada Health's Receivables Turnover for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

Receivables Turnover (Q: Mar. 2026 )
=Revenue / Average Accounts Receivable
=Revenue (Q: Mar. 2026 ) / ((Accounts Receivable (Q: Dec. 2025 ) + Accounts Receivable (Q: Mar. 2026 )) / count )
=78.048 / ((13.563 + 13.604) / 2 )
=78.048 / 13.5835
=5.75

Omada Health Business Description

Other Exchanges U76:Germany
Address 611 Gateway Boulevard, Suite 120, South San Francisco, CA, USA, 94080
Omada Health Inc empowers individuals to make lasting health changes through personalized, virtual care between doctor's visits. The integrated platform of the company supports members with cardiometabolic conditions like prediabetes, diabetes, hypertension, musculoskeletal issues, and behavioral health needs. The company's specialized care tracks also assist members using GLP-1 medications. The company delivers measurable health outcomes and value for employers, health plans, health systems, and pharmacy benefit managers.
